Zears Andro Z5 vs Lava Iris X1 4GB
Comparing the Zears Andro Z5 vs Lava Iris X1 4GB across performance, display, camera, battery and storage to help determine the better smartphone.
Here is the summary of the results:
Performance: Both Zears Andro Z5 and Lava Iris X1 4GB run at the same processing speed of 1.2 GHz.
Display: Zears Andro Z5 offers a screen size of 5 inches, while Lava Iris X1 4GB offers 4.5 inches, making Zears Andro Z5 the larger display of the two. Lava Iris X1 4GB features a IPS LCD display compared to Zears Andro Z5's LCD, making Lava Iris X1 4GB the better display of the two.
Rear Camera: Both Zears Andro Z5 and Lava Iris X1 4GB feature a 8 MP primary rear camera.
Front Camera: Lava Iris X1 4GB offers a higher front camera resolution with 2 MP, while Zears Andro Z5 offers 1.3 MP, making Lava Iris X1 4GB better for front camera photography.
Battery: Zears Andro Z5 offers a higher battery capacity with 2350 mAh, while Lava Iris X1 4GB offers 1800 mAh, making Zears Andro Z5 better for longer battery life.
Storage: Both Zears Andro Z5 and Lava Iris X1 4GB offer the same internal storage of 4 GB.
